BSAVE |
Sauvegarde binaire |
---|---|
QuickBASIC/QBasic |
Syntaxe
BSAVE nomfichier,offset,longueur |
Paramètres
Nom | Description | |
---|---|---|
nomfichier | Ce paramètre permet d'indiquer le nom du fichier à sauvegarder en mémoire. En plus des noms de fichiers, les périphériques suivants sont reconnus par la commande «BSAVE» : | |
Valeur | Description | |
CONS: | Cette valeur permet d'indiquer qu'il faut utilisé la console comme destination de sortie. | |
SCRN: | Cette valeur permet d'indiquer qu'il faut utilisé l'adresse mémoire de l'écran destination de sortie. | |
offset | Ce paramètre permet d'indiquer le déplacement à effectuer dans le Segment BASIC. La valeur de ce paramètre doit être situé entre 0 et 65535. | |
longueur | Ce paramètre permet d'indiquer la longueur des données à sauvegarder. La valeur de ce paramètre doit être situé entre 0 et 65535. |
Description
Cette commande permet de sauver des données binaire dans un fichier.
Remarques
- Si aucune unité de disque n'est pas spécifié dans le paramètre du nom de fichier, alors la commande effectuera la lecture sur l'unité courante.
- Le déplacement est basé est basé sur le segment définit par la commande «DEF SEG».
- Si l'instruction «DEF SEG» n'est pas spécifié, la commande «BSAVE» utilisera le segment de données du BASIC (registre DS du microprocesseur) par défaut.
- Si le déplacement est valeur réel de simple ou de double précision, elle sera convertie en entier. Si le déplacement est un nombre négatif, il sera convertir un nombre naturel contenu sur 2 octets.
- Contrairement au BASICA/GWBASIC, cette commande ne supporter pas le périphérique de cassette.
Voir également
Langage de programmation - QuickBASIC/QBasic - Référence de procédures et de fonctions - BLOAD
Langage de programmation - QuickBASIC/QBasic - Référence de procédures et de fonctions - DEF SEG
Langage de programmation - QuickBASIC/QBasic - Référence de procédures et de fonctions - VARPTR
Langage de programmation - QuickBASIC/QBasic - Référence de procédures et de fonctions - VARSEG
Langage de programmation - QuickBASIC/QBasic - Référence de procédures et de fonctions - INPUT
Dernière mise à jour : Mercredi, le 14 septembre 2016